Timezone in Changping
Changping is located in the Asia/Shanghai timezone, which operates at a UTC offset of +8 hours. This means that when it is noon in Coordinated Universal Time, it is 8 PM in Changping. China does not observe daylight saving time, so this offset remains constant throughout the year.

Attractions and Activities in Changping
Changping, located in the northern part of Beijing, is known for its rich cultural heritage and historical significance. It is home to several ancient sites, including the Ming Tombs, which are the burial sites of 13 emperors from the Ming Dynasty. This area showcases traditional Chinese architecture and provides insight into the imperial history of China.

Practical Information for Visitors
Changping is well-connected, making it accessible for visitors. The nearest major airport is Beijing Capital International Airport, which is about an hour’s drive away. From the airport, travelers can take a taxi or use ride-hailing services to reach Changping.
The Beijing subway also offers a convenient line to Changping, connecting to other parts of the city. Additionally, several bus routes serve the area, providing further options for getting around. The climate in Changping is characterized by hot summers and cold winters, typical of northern China.
Summer temperatures can soar above 30 degrees Celsius, while winter temperatures often drop below freezing. The best time to visit Changping is during the spring (April to June) and autumn (September to October) when the weather is mild and pleasant, making it ideal for outdoor activities.
